part of speech: |
noun |
definition 1: |
high public value or respect.
The mayor holds a place of honor in our community.- synonyms:
- distinction, esteem, respect
- antonyms:
- contempt, dishonor, scorn, shame
- similar words:
- admiration, approval, credit, face, favor, glory, note, prestige, reputation
|
definition 2: |
the state of having a good character and honest behavior.
A person of honor will not cheat her friends.- synonyms:
- honesty, integrity, truthfulness, uprightness
- similar words:
- chivalry, face, morality, virtue
|
definition 3: |
acknowledgement or recognition.
We celebrate this day in honor of our nation's founder.She received a medal in honor of her academic achievement. |
definition 4: |
a special award.
The soldiers who fought in that battle received honors from the general.- synonyms:
- award, tribute
- antonyms:
- demerit
- similar words:
- acknowledgment, decoration, laurels, prize, recognition, reward, trophy
|
definition 5: |
a privilege that makes you feel proud.
It is an honor to meet you, Sir Charles.- synonyms:
- privilege
|
definition 6: |
a source of pride or credit.
That doctor is an honor to her profession.- synonyms:
- credit, pride and joy
- antonyms:
- disgrace
- similar words:
- advantage, benefit, glory, joy, ornament, plus

part of speech: |
verb |
inflections: |
honors, honoring, honored |
definition 1: |
to feel or show respect or admiration for.
We honored our mother on Mother's Day.- synonyms:
- admire, esteem, respect
- antonyms:
- abuse, disrespect
- similar words:
- appreciate, consecrate, favor, prize, revere, value
|
definition 2: |
to give a special award or recognition to.
The world champions were honored by the President.- synonyms:
- reward
- antonyms:
- humiliate
- similar words:
- acclaim, commend, decorate, praise, recognize
